To a window washer, social distancing is part of the job.

Hanging off the side of a building, glass separating the technician and the inside offices its a job that adapts well to the era of Covid-19. So long as clients are still paying for the service, that is.

Thats the challenge facing KEVCO Building Services. Kenny Cohn, president of the family-owned Gaithersburg company, says the next few months for his business hinge on whether the residential and commercial customers prioritize window cleaning, garage cleaning and power washing services. So far, business has remained relatively stable given the environment. Bookings are down around 15% some postponed, some canceled completely.

But Kenny built the company with conservative growth, with little debt weighing on his mind as revenue slows.

Its serving us well now, he says. This is a time that will definitely bring us closer together.

Kenny launched KEVCO in 1988 after years washing windows in college.
